Fatal Bear Attack in Poland Reignites Calls for Regulatory Changes
The tragic death of a 58-year-old woman following a bear attack in Płonna has sparked renewed debate on safety in the Bieszczady and Beskidy mountains, with local authorities demanding changes to regulations.
